The Willows Care Home, makes an excellent contribution to the lives of older and vulnerable adults in Salford, all of whom receive quality and personalised care.

Trained staff are available throughout the day and night, supporting the resident's personal interests and promoting an active daily life, while maintaining an atmosphere that is relaxing and homely.

Funding & Fees

Weekly Charges per Person

Type of carePermanentRespite
Residential Care£1,100 - £1,300£1,100 - £1,300
Residential Dementia Care£1,100 - £1,300£1,100 - £1,300
Nursing Care£1,300 - £1,500£1,300 - £1,500
Nursing Dementia Care£1,300 - £1,500£1,300 - £1,500

Our fees are based on dependency levels and therefore may alter, please feel free to contact the home to discuss further.

Support you may be entitled to

  • If you chose a care home based in England, you may be eligible for NHS Funded Nursing Care (FNC), which helps cover the cost of nursing. This is worth £267.68 per week and is usually paid directly to the care home.
